PRR Double "Decapod" Pushers, 2-10-0, c. 1945 |
| Description: |
Here is an original photo of two Pennsylvania Railroad "I" Class (2-10-0) "Decapod" steam locomotives pushing a fully-loaded mineral train. Partially visible at the right is PRR N-5 cabin car #477784. The photographer's name, the locomotive road numbers, the exact date, and the location are not recorded. Roy Healey Collection; #4 of 16. |

PRR Triple-Header, c. 1945 |
| Description: |
Here is an original photo of three Pennsylvania Railroad locomotives pulling one of the world's shortest freight trains, concluded by PRR N-5 caboose #477784. Note that the second two engines are running backwards! The photographer's name, the locomotive road numbers, the exact date, and the location are not recorded. Roy Healey Collection; #16 of 16. |
